Instructional Assistant Salary in New York

How much does an Instructional Assistant make in New York?

As of August 01, 2026, the average salary for an Instructional Assistant in New York is $38,938 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$19.

However, an Instructional Assistant's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$45,380
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$34,972 to $42,310
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$31,361

Key Factors That Influence Instructional Assistant Salaries

An Instructional Assistant's salary isn't a fixed number. It's shaped by several important factors. Below, we'll explore how your years of experience, geographic location and company size can directly affect your earning potential.

How Experience Level Affects Instructional Assistant Salaries?

Experience is a primary driver of an Instructional Assistant's salary. As you build your skills and take on more complex tasks, your compensation generally increases. Here’s how the average salary grows at different career stages:

  • Entry-Level (less than 1 year): $36,861
  • Early Career (1-2 years): $37,166
  • Mid-Level (2-4 years): $38,690
  • Senior-Level (5-8 years): $39,930
  • Expert (over 8 years): $40,574

Instructional Assistant Salary by Industry: Top Paying Sectors

For Instructional Assistant roles, the industry you choose can affect earning potential by as much as 100% (the gap between the highest and lowest paying industries). Data shows that the Healthcare and Business Services sectors offer the strongest compensation, at 50% above the average. In contrast, Instructional Assistant positions in Hospitality & Leisure or Edu., Gov't. & Nonprofit typically offer lower base pay, as these industries often view Instructional Assistant as a support function rather than a direct revenue driver.
